Read MoreTransversal vibrations of a screen for a fine granular material are studied using both analytical and numerical methods. In the analytical approach the motion of the screen is described by partial differential equations. The general solution of the screen free vibrations is derived from variables separation method. In the numerical computations the finite element method is applied.

Read MoreBuffers have higher dynamic loads but are suited to wet applications. The number and types of buffers or springs is determined by the mass of the screen. 2. Vibrating mechanism Screens are vibrated in linear motion using geared exciters with contra rotating out of balance masses.
Read MoreDeflection shape (ODS) analysis was used to examine the screen behavior under actual operating conditions. This information is helpful in determining how to modify the screen body to reduce the noise radiated by the screen below 1 kHz. The analysis showed modal vibration patterns on the sides and feed box were the main contributors to noise.
